Storing Champagne for 170 Years Is Possible!
In 2010, a shipwreck was discovered at around 50 meters depth on the floor of the Baltic Sea, containing 168 bottles of what turned out to be Champagne. When the divers found the wine they were astonished: "We drank one, it's still good!" ...

Farewell to Cork: consumers prefer screw caps
Farewell, dear cork: screw caps are winning over more and more consumers! Farewell to the cork stopper – according to a survey conducted by IPSOS, a growing number of consumers prefer opening fine wine bottles with an aluminium cap, drawing increasing consensus especially from foreign consumers...
